Subject: Re: [dpdk-dev] [PATCH] crypto: remove unused digest-appended feature

On 17/11/16 17:33, Fiona Trahe wrote:
> The cryptodev API had specified that if the digest address field was
> left empty on an authentication operation, then the PMD would assume
> the digest was appended to the source or destination data.
> This case was not handled at all by most PMDs and incorrectly handled
> by the QAT PMD.
> As no bugs were raised, it is assumed to be not needed, so this patch
> removes it, rather than add handling for the case on all PMDs.
> The digest can still be appended to the data, but its
> address must now be provided in the op.
